Overview

The Surface Consumer Lead, Microsoft Digital Stores, Americas is responsible for delivering the revenue, margin, growth, and customer satisfaction targets for the Microsoft Store Direct Americas business for Surface. This role provides end-to-end ownership of the Surface Consumer Line of Business (LOB) across the Americas region and partners closely with cross-functional teams to ensure business plans are aligned, field teams are informed and prepared, and execution is consistent and effective across key priorities. Responsibilities

Planning

• Define and evolve the last-mile go-to-market (GTM) framework across products, including structuring and prioritizing GTM programs to drive scalable, customer-relevant execution

• Translate product and campaign priorities into customer-relevant execution plans for the Americas, aligning stakeholders on timelines, deliverables, and dependencies

• Drive readiness and continuously improve GTM processes and playbooks, incorporating performance and customer insights to enhance execution effectiveness 

Execution

• Drive last-mile execution of product launches, campaigns, and GTM programs across Digital Stores in the Americas, ensuring quality and alignment to plan

• Execute regional GTM programs end-to-end, coordinating across internal stakeholders and external partners to deliver customer-relevant outcomes

• Test, iterate, and scale new locally relevant customer ideas and pilots, identifying high-impact opportunities and operationalizing successful programs 

Measure & Monitor

• Track and analyze performance across launches and GTM programs, identifying key drivers and opportunities to optimize customer     outcomes

• Synthesize and communicate performance and customer insights to inform prioritization, program refinement, and future planning

• Evaluate effectiveness of GTM programs and pilots, leveraging data and customer feedback to improve execution and inform scale decisions

eCommerce IC4 - The typical base pay range for this role across the U.S. is USD $106,400 - $203,600 per year. There is a different range applicable to specific work locations, within the San Francisco Bay area and New York City metropolitan area, and the base pay range for this role in those locations is USD $137,600 - $222,600 per year.
